United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is looking for a driven Business Development Lead in Norwich to join their team. In this pivotal role, you will generate leads and build a clientele while maintaining accurate records in the CRM system.

The position offers a competitive commission structure with no cap on On Target Earnings, making it an excellent opportunity for ambitious individuals.

If you have proven experience in sales, strong communication skills, and a proactive approach, we want to hear from you!

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

✨Know Your Numbers

Before the interview, brush up on your sales metrics and achievements. Be ready to discuss specific figures that showcase your success in generating leads and closing deals. This will demonstrate your capability and confidence in a results-driven role.

✨Master the CRM

Familiarise yourself with common CRM systems, especially if you know which one the company uses. Highlight your experience with CRM tools during the interview, and be prepared to discuss how you've used them to track leads and manage client relationships effectively.

✨Showcase Your Communication Skills

Since strong communication is key for this role, practice artic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. Consider preparing a few examples of how you've successfully communicated with clients or colleagues to overcome challenges or close deals.

✨Be Proactive in Your Approach

Demonstrate your proactive nature by discussing how you've taken initiative in previous roles. Share specific instances where you went above and beyond to generate leads or improve processes, as this aligns perfectly with what they’re looking for in a Business Development Executive.
